The Council of Europe's Committee of Experts on Blood Transfusion and Immunohaematology, which included Dr Gunson, published a report addressing surrogate screening for NANBH.

A letter published in the The Lance by Dr Contreras and colleagues at the North London Blood Transfusion Centre commented that if "the true incidence of post-transfusion NANB hepatitis and its serious clinical sequelae are at a much lower level than reported from the USA, then screening of donations to reduce the incidence of NANB hepatitis may not be cost effective in the UK".

Dr Gunson completed a funding application for a multi-centre study into surrogate testing and ALT.

Dr Scott in an internal minute written to Dr McIntyre believed "we should prevent the BTS from doing a full scale introduction" of surrogate testing.

In oral evidence given to the Inquiry, Dr Morris McClelland explained that he could not recall whether the SNBTS guidelines regarding surrogate testing were adhered to and he followed "National decision making" in reference to surrogate testing in Northern Ireland.

De Kernoff and Dr Colvin stated in a paper for the Haemophilia Working Party that the acute NANBH, appeared generally mild, though might sometimes be fatal, but the chronic NANBH seemed "very possible that there may be serious long-term sequelae"

Professor Cash wrote to Dr Gunson, suggesting he should not take the content of the minutes in relation to surrogate testing "too seriously at this stage" as "the results of the UK study are unlikely to have a material affect [sic] on future operational practice."

Dr Gunson wrote that it was incorrect that "no Scottish Centre was now being asked to participate" in the multi-centre study and that he was "dismayed" to read SNBT would be applying for funding for surrogate testing from 1 April 1988, as he had understood that "Scotland would not take unilateral action" in introducing surrogate testing without consultation with regional transfusion directors in England and Wales
